forum.bitel.ru http://forum.bitel.ru/ |
|
5.2 Смена тарифов через web http://forum.bitel.ru/viewtopic.php?f=22&t=6947 |
Страница 1 из 1 |
Автор: | dmitry_P [ 09 июл 2012, 15:25 ] |
Заголовок сообщения: | 5.2 Смена тарифов через web |
После перехода на 5.2 происходят странные вещи с вебинтерфейсом, когда абоненты меняют тарифные планы, в договор зачастую заносятся 2 одинаковых тарифа, потом начиляются 2 абонплаты и договор закрывается. Также при понижении лимита через веб иногда генерятся 2 задачи по восстановлению лимита для договора и в результате у договора становится плюсовой лимит. Такие вещи происходят не каждый раз, поэтому систему отловить не смогли. Помогите разобраться. Клиент: вер. 5.2 сборка 997 от 08.06.2012 17:54:40 os: Windows XP; java: Java HotSpot(TM) Client VM, v.1.6.0_30 Сервер: вер. 5.2 сборка 1208 от 08.06.2012 17:54:45 os: Linux; java: Java HotSpot(TM) 64-Bit Server VM, v.1.6.0_31 bill вер. 5.2 сборка 262 от 05.06.2012 16:47:50 card вер. 5.2 сборка 178 от 05.06.2012 16:47:51 cerbercrypt вер. 5.2 сборка 196 от 08.06.2012 13:41:24 dialup вер. 5.2 сборка 342 от 08.06.2012 13:41:31 email вер. 5.2 сборка 166 от 08.06.2012 13:41:32 gorod вер. 5.2 сборка 149 от 17.05.2012 15:29:04 inet вер. 5.2 сборка 906 от 08.06.2012 14:18:40 ipn вер. 5.2 сборка 229 от 08.06.2012 13:41:33 npay вер. 5.2 сборка 182 от 02.06.2012 03:52:05 phone вер. 5.2 сборка 234 от 08.06.2012 13:41:48 reports вер. 5.2 сборка 175 от 17.05.2012 15:29:23 rscm вер. 5.2 сборка 160 от 31.05.2012 16:14:42 ru.bitel.bgbilling.plugins.cashcheck вер. 5.2 сборка 101 от 19.03.2012 12:57:09 ru.bitel.bgbilling.plugins.crm вер. 5.2 сборка 179 от 29.05.2012 14:38:06 ru.bitel.bgbilling.plugins.dispatch вер. 5.2 сборка 37 от 10.05.2012 13:26:18 ru.bitel.bgbilling.plugins.documents вер. 5.2 сборка 142 от 01.06.2012 16:21:15 ru.bitel.bgbilling.plugins.helpdesk вер. 5.2 сборка 161 от 05.05.2012 13:29:29 ru.bitel.bgbilling.plugins.organizer вер. 5.2 сборка 57 от 13.03.2012 14:04:11 trayinfo вер. 5.2 сборка 156 от 17.05.2012 12:21:25 voiceip вер. 5.2 сборка 181 от 04.06.2012 21:38:19 wm вер. 5.2 сборка 169 от 17.05.2012 15:29:27 |
Автор: | stark [ 09 июл 2012, 15:34 ] |
Заголовок сообщения: | Re: 5.2 Смена тарифов через web |
dmitry_P писал(а): Сервер: вер. 5.2 сборка 1208 от 08.06.2012 17:54:45 Цитата: 1217 18.06.2012 21:19:43 ДОБАВЛЕНО Защита от двойного клика в личном кабинет пользователя.
|
Автор: | dmitry_P [ 17 июл 2012, 16:30 ] |
Заголовок сообщения: | Re: 5.2 Смена тарифов через web |
Обновились. Ситуацию с двойными тарифами пока вроде не наблюдаем. Вылазят похоже только старые удвоенные задания на смену. Но с понижением лимита проблема осталась. Генерятся двойные понижения и сервер поднимает клиентам лимит в плюс и отрубает. Ситуация с абонентами накаляется все больше. Встает вопрос о смене биллинга. |
Автор: | stark [ 17 июл 2012, 17:03 ] |
Заголовок сообщения: | Re: 5.2 Смена тарифов через web |
dmitry_P писал(а): Обновились. Ситуацию с двойными тарифами пока вроде не наблюдаем. Вылазят похоже только старые удвоенные задания на смену. Но с понижением лимита проблема осталась. Генерятся двойные понижения и сервер поднимает клиентам лимит в плюс и отрубает. Ситуация с абонентами накаляется все больше. Встает вопрос о смене биллинга. А вы в тех. поддержку пробовали обращаться ? Она для подобных вопросов и существует. У двойных понижений лимита скорее всего другая причина . Там у одной из таблиц произошло обнуление индекса у одного из клиентов(причем непонятно почему , такое происходит если он сам вызвал TRUNCATE на этой таблице, но говорит что не делал , поэтому как вариант рассматривалась версию перехода с myisam на inndodb) , после этого выложили обновление, но там все равно надо руками таблицу поменять . Это надо зайти к вам и посмотреть, возможно у вас так же причина . Напишите в helpdesk или дайте доступ в личку. |
Автор: | dmitry_P [ 17 июл 2012, 17:15 ] |
Заголовок сообщения: | Re: 5.2 Смена тарифов через web |
http://billing.bitel.ru/webexecuter?act ... ctId=1882# Доступ давали здесь и еще не закрывали. Но что-то много платных услуг требуется после перехода на 5.2 |
Автор: | dimOn [ 17 июл 2012, 18:11 ] |
Заголовок сообщения: | Re: 5.2 Смена тарифов через web |
О чём вы говорите? Какие платные услуги потребовались? |
Автор: | Phricker [ 17 июл 2012, 18:33 ] |
Заголовок сообщения: | Re: 5.2 Смена тарифов через web |
Априори считается что обращение в хелпдекс - платное ))) И кстати благодаря какому-то dim0n'у с его helpdesk - $$$ - доработка - профит! ![]() ![]() Люди ж не знают, что косяки биллинга исправляются бесплатно ![]() |
Автор: | dmitry_P [ 17 июл 2012, 20:19 ] |
Заголовок сообщения: | Re: 5.2 Смена тарифов через web |
На нашем биллинге и не забесплатно обкатывали разницу между SSHSessionExec и SSHSession для 5.2. Вы сами признали, что трабла с SSHSessionExec - суть ошибка в библиотеке. Я бы цитату выложил, но в ссылка на закрытыю тему в Хелпдеске не открывается (бага?). Помучались с SSHSession, признали необходимость внедрения класса для работы с микротиками по API (пробовал до отпуска - с лету не работает, теперь буду ковырять). Никаких таблиц я в базе не вычищал. На InnoDB перевел все кроме log_XXXXXX, как и сказано в инструкции по переходу. Что-то сложно все и света в конце не видать. А можно сказать какую таблицу проверить? Или цену вашей проверки? |
Автор: | Phricker [ 17 июл 2012, 21:21 ] |
Заголовок сообщения: | Re: 5.2 Смена тарифов через web |
dmitry_P писал(а): Я бы цитату выложил, но в ссылка на закрытыю тему в Хелпдеске не открывается (бага?) Проблемы с ХД последние 3-5 дней. Пользуйтесь старой версией (в хелпдеске есть ссылка, что если что то не работает - пользуйтесь старой версией) |
Автор: | stark [ 18 июл 2012, 10:55 ] |
Заголовок сообщения: | Re: 5.2 Смена тарифов через web |
dmitry_P писал(а): На нашем биллинге и не забесплатно обкатывали разницу между SSHSessionExec и SSHSession для 5.2. Вы сами признали, что трабла с SSHSessionExec - суть ошибка в библиотеке. А вашем варианте с SSHSessionExec не работает из-за ошибки в библиотеке. Да, ошибка в СТОРОННЕЙ библиотеке jsch. У вас скрипт работал долго , мы определили почему и выяснили причину, почему не работает. вам помогли его настроить чтобы работал быстро, проблему решили. То что не работает с SSHSessionExec - это не наша проблема , там ошибка у разработчиков jsch. |
Автор: | stark [ 18 июл 2012, 11:04 ] |
Заголовок сообщения: | Re: 5.2 Смена тарифов через web |
dmitry_P писал(а): Никаких таблиц я в базе не вычищал. На InnoDB перевел все кроме log_XXXXXX, как и сказано в инструкции по переходу. Что-то сложно все и света в конце не видать. А можно сказать какую таблицу проверить? Или цену вашей проверки? Да несложно..Я просто хотел сам посмотреть , если это системное явления , надо с этим что-то делать . Возможно у вас вообще не в этом причина . Проблема в том, что если это ошибка , наждо смотреть логи и т.п , для этого нужен доступ . Вот цитата из общения с тем, клиентом , у которого была проблема Цитата: На этой базе я понял что у вас происходит.. Есть таблица contract_limit_period. В нее добавляются задачи на добавление лимита . А есть таблица contract_limit_manage, в нее добавляется запись если пользователь понижает себе лимит из Web. contract_limit_manage.clp_id = contract_limit_period.id. Задача восстановления лимита берет записи из contract_limit_period и удаляет их. При этом она у соответствующей записи(по clp_id ) в contract_limit_manage ставит status =2. Но если посмотреть на таблицу contract_limit_manage: select * from contract_limit_manage order by id То видно что поле cld_id увеличивается до 124, потом снова начинается с 1-цы. Это означает что поле id из contract_limit_period снова началось с 1. Это происходит где-то с 17-28 апреля 2012 года . Возможно вы перешли на innodb, или вызвали TRUNCATE TABLE contract_limit_period, или какая-то друга я причина Проверьте у вас то же самое или нет . |
Автор: | stark [ 18 июл 2012, 11:16 ] |
Заголовок сообщения: | Re: 5.2 Смена тарифов через web |
я посмотрел. У вас вроде бы нет этой проблемы . Надо смотреть конкретные договора, где это случилось и разбираться почему . Создайте тему в helpdesk, напишите на каких договорах смотреть. Если это наша ошибка , то обращение будет бесплатным . |
Автор: | stark [ 18 июл 2012, 11:19 ] |
Заголовок сообщения: | Re: 5.2 Смена тарифов через web |
кстати можете выложить еще скриншот лога изменения лимита . Иногда там все правильно . Иногда бывает что в процесс восстановления лимита влезают операторы и по логу видно что все правильно , но оператор просто не понял, что сам накосячил . Я не могу гадать теоретически , что там у вас произошло . Нужны факты, доступ и т.п . |
Автор: | dmitry_P [ 18 июл 2012, 12:04 ] |
Заголовок сообщения: | Re: 5.2 Смена тарифов через web |
Тему создал |
Страница 1 из 1 | Часовой пояс: UTC + 5 часов [ Летнее время ] |
Powered by phpBB® Forum Software © phpBB Group http://www.phpbb.com/ |